Itunes not opening - error message that file is locked....
Hi,
itunes message - 'library file is locked, on a locked disk, or you do not have write permission for this file.'
I've tried everything i can find online to repair this issue, but itunes wont open still. I saw a message for this exact message in 2006 about moving itune lib to desktop and then back into itunes folder, but that hasn't worked. Please help.
Might fix your problem:
Through Finder navigate to your users directory
Select the folder "Music"
Press CMD-i
An info windows will pop up
Scroll down to the very bottom
If necessary expand "Sharing & Permissions"
Is your username listed with Privilege "Read & Write"?
Tick the little lock at bottom right - enter your PW
If necessary correct your privileges
In any case press the little gearwheel - "Apply to enclosed items ..."
ok
reboot

I just tried to play some songs that i have in itunes and i get an error message that says file can't be located. It appears to be on about half the songs of the thousands I have in there. I do have a new computer and transferred the itunes library about a month ago. I have successfully managed ipod on new computer. I wonder if it is a licensing issue but this is just the second computer althought the third hard drive these songs have been on. It is affecting songs loaded from CD's and purchased from itunes on the old computer alike.
Hi angela dfromtx,
When tracks in iTunes display a it means the file cannot be located; it may have been moved or deleted. You'll have to locate the file manually if it is still available. For more information refer to the following article:
iTunes: Finding lost media and downloads
http://support.apple.com/kb/TS1408
Alternatively, if your media was downloaded from the iTunes Store, you may be able to download it again free of charge:
Downloading past purchases from the App Store, iBookstore, and iTunes Store
http://support.apple.com/kb/HT2519

Quicktime and itunes will not open error message
I think their is suppose to be two files (QuickTime.qts and QuickTimeVR.qtx) in the systems 32 folder. But there is a quick.ime also in the folder, do I delete it so that my quicktime and itunes work.
No, quick.ime is not part of Quicktime. Don't delete it.
If Quicktime will not open, then iTunes can't work.
Can you give the Quicktime error message in full, and also check in your Windows error logs or Problems & solutions to see if there is more information there.
You haven't given your Windows version which helps when troubleshooting. -
